Responsibilities:

  • Provide customer service to clients and visitors by carrying out security-related procedures and site-specific policies, as well as responding to emergencies when appropriate.
  • Respond to incidents and critical situations in a calm, problem-solving manner to help address issues as they arise.
  • Conduct regular and random patrols throughout the location, including the business and perimeter, to help to deter unauthorized activity and maintain a visible presence.
  • Monitor and report any unusual activities or conditions within the premises, escalating concerns to appropriate personnel when needed.
  • Maintain detailed logs and reports of daily activities, incidents, and observations as required by Allied Universal and site protocols.
  • Assist employees, visitors, and contractors with access control and directions within the location.
  • Support Allied Universal team members and site management by communicating relevant information promptly and professionally.
